In 2021, Bahrs Scrub - Wolffdene - Belivah had lower proportion of children (under 18) and a lower proportion of persons aged 60 or older than Division 5.

The Age Structure of Bahrs Scrub - Wolffdene - Belivah provides key insights into the level of demand for age based services and facilities such as child care. It is an indicator of Bahrs Scrub - Wolffdene - Belivah's residential role and function and how it is likely to change in the future.

Service age groups divide the population into age categories that reflect typical life-stages. They indicate the level of demand for services that target people at different stages in life and how that demand is changing.

To get a more complete picture Bahrs Scrub - Wolffdene - Belivah's Age Structure should be viewed in conjunction with Household Types and Dwelling Types.

Dominant groups

Analysis of the service age groups of Bahrs Scrub - Wolffdene - Belivah in 2021 compared to Division 5 shows that there was a lower proportion of people in the younger age groups (0 to 17 years) as well as a lower proportion of people in the older age groups (60+ years).

Overall, 27.1% of the population was aged between 0 and 17, and 12.3% were aged 60 years and over, compared with 31.9% and 14.1% respectively for Division 5.

The major differences between the age structure of Bahrs Scrub - Wolffdene - Belivah and Division 5 were:

  • A larger percentage of 'Young workforce' (21.6% compared to 14.7%)
  • A smaller percentage of 'Primary schoolers' (10.2% compared to 12.9%)
  • A smaller percentage of 'Secondary schoolers' (8.0% compared to 10.3%)
  • A smaller percentage of 'Parents and homebuilders' (17.7% compared to 19.0%)

Emerging groups

From 2016 to 2021, Bahrs Scrub - Wolffdene - Belivah's population increased by 2,762 people (109.3%). This represents an average annual population change of 15.92% per year over the period.

The largest changes in the age structure in this area between 2016 and 2021 were in the age groups:

  • Young workforce (25 to 34) (+769 people)
  • Parents and homebuilders (35 to 49) (+466 people)
  • Tertiary education and independence (18 to 24) (+306 people)
  • Babies and pre-schoolers (0 to 4) (+292 people)
